"ALL FOR ME" FRIZE

i— Presa Association.)

Winner Could Not Reep Good Luck a Secret

(By I'elegraot

CHRISTCHURCH, This Day. The winner of the £2000 prize in All For Me" Art, Union is Mr. Pai; Consedine, single, aged 22 yearSj, who lives with his widowed moiher at 167 Edinburgh street, Spreydon. Mr; Consedine wanted to keep his goqd luek a close secret, ifut he could no,t resist the temptation to tell a numher of friends, with the result that to-day the secret leaked out. Mr. Consedine ia employed by a motor mechanic, and about a month agq met with an accident which caus.ed an injury fo jds leg, and he still haSj to xeceive daily massage tre%tment. The vfiuner ' spqnt this morning . in the company qf his, employer, kgeping well clear of newspaper" reporters auJ salesmen.
